comparison level2/coco3/modules/makefile @ 2547:141cfa8a4302

Added
author boisy
date Sat, 12 Jun 2010 12:15:54 +0000
parents 0aaf20430b33
children 17d43fd29ee2
comparison
equal deleted inserted replaced
2546:f0977fc3f2d6 2547:141cfa8a4302
18 18
19 DEPENDS = ./makefile 19 DEPENDS = ./makefile
20 TPB = ../../3rdparty/booters 20 TPB = ../../3rdparty/booters
21 21
22 BOOTERS = boot_1773_6ms boot_1773_30ms \ 22 BOOTERS = boot_1773_6ms boot_1773_30ms \
23 boot_burke boot_rampak boot_wd1002 boot_dw3 23 boot_burke boot_rampak boot_wd1002 boot_dw3 boot_dw3_becker
24 BOOTTRACK = rel_32 rel_40 rel_80 rel_32_50hz rel_40_50hz rel_80_50hz $(BOOTERS) krn 24 BOOTTRACK = rel_32 rel_40 rel_80 rel_32_50hz rel_40_50hz rel_80_50hz $(BOOTERS) krn
25 KERNEL = krnp2 krnp3_perr krnp4_regdump 25 KERNEL = krnp2 krnp3_perr krnp4_regdump
26 SYSMODS = ioman init sysgo_h0 sysgo_dd 26 SYSMODS = ioman init sysgo_h0 sysgo_dd
27 CLOCKS = clock_60hz clock_50hz \ 27 CLOCKS = clock_60hz clock_50hz \
28 clock2_elim clock2_disto2 clock2_disto4 clock2_bnb \ 28 clock2_elim clock2_disto2 clock2_disto4 clock2_bnb \
29 clock2_smart clock2_harris clock2_cloud9 clock2_soft \ 29 clock2_smart clock2_harris clock2_cloud9 clock2_soft \
30 clock2_jvemu clock2_messemu clock2_dw3 30 clock2_jvemu clock2_messemu clock2_dw3 clock2_dw3_becker
31 31
32 RBF = rbf.mn \ 32 RBF = rbf.mn \
33 rbdw3.dr dw3.sb \ 33 rbdw3.dr dw3.sb dw3_becker.sb \
34 rb1773.dr rb1773_scii_ff74.dr rb1773_scii_ff58.dr \ 34 rb1773.dr rb1773_scii_ff74.dr rb1773_scii_ff58.dr \
35 d0_35s.dd d1_35s.dd d2_35s.dd d3_35s.dd \ 35 d0_35s.dd d1_35s.dd d2_35s.dd d3_35s.dd \
36 d0_40d.dd d1_40d.dd d2_40d.dd d0_80d.dd \ 36 d0_40d.dd d1_40d.dd d2_40d.dd d0_80d.dd \
37 d1_80d.dd d2_80d.dd \ 37 d1_80d.dd d2_80d.dd \
38 ddd0_35s.dd ddd0_40d.dd ddd0_80d.dd \ 38 ddd0_35s.dd ddd0_40d.dd ddd0_80d.dd \
84 krn krnp2: 84 krn krnp2:
85 $(CD) kernel; make $@ 85 $(CD) kernel; make $@
86 $(CP) kernel/$@ . 86 $(CP) kernel/$@ .
87 87
88 # Special cases 88 # Special cases
89 boot_dw3_becker: boot_dw3.asm
90 $(AS) $< $(ASOUT)$@ $(AFLAGS) -aBECKER=1
91
92 dw3_becker.sb: dw3.asm
93 $(AS) $< $(ASOUT)$@ $(AFLAGS) -aBECKER=1
94
89 cogrf.io: cowin.asm 95 cogrf.io: cowin.asm
90 $(AS) $< $(ASOUT)$@ $(AFLAGS) -aCoGrf=1 96 $(AS) $< $(ASOUT)$@ $(AFLAGS) -aCoGrf=1
91 97
92 rb1773_scii_ff74.dr: rb1773.asm 98 rb1773_scii_ff74.dr: rb1773.asm
93 $(AS) $< $(ASOUT)$@ $(AFLAGS) -aSCII=1 99 $(AS) $< $(ASOUT)$@ $(AFLAGS) -aSCII=1
296 $(AS) $(AFLAGS) $(ASOUT)$@ $< -aCLOUD9=1 302 $(AS) $(AFLAGS) $(ASOUT)$@ $< -aCLOUD9=1
297 303
298 clock2_bnb: clock2_ds1315.asm 304 clock2_bnb: clock2_ds1315.asm
299 $(AS) $(AFLAGS) $(ASOUT)$@ $< -aBNB=1 305 $(AS) $(AFLAGS) $(ASOUT)$@ $< -aBNB=1
300 306
307 clock2_dw3_becker: clock2_dw3.asm
308 $(AS) $(AFLAGS) $(ASOUT)$@ $< -aBECKER=1
309
301 clean: 310 clean:
302 $(CD) kernel; make $@ 311 $(CD) kernel; make $@
303 $(RM) $(ALLOBJS) 312 $(RM) $(ALLOBJS)
304 313
305 showobjs: 314 showobjs: